A Short Term Apartment Rentals in Jimbour QLD agreement should include the address of the property being rented, the dates and times that the renter will have access to the property, age, and maximum occupancy rules, payment policies, check out procedures, cancellation policies and the rules related to the property, for example rules regarding pets, smoking, and pool or utility use. If the property is located in an area where storms or hurricanes may happen, a clause may be added if there's a mandatory evacuation that allows for refunds or cancellations.

If you own a vacation rental house, you should have a lawyer look over your rental agreement to be sure that it's in compliance with all applicable laws. Also, make sure your agreement complies with all rules and covenants that may be unique to your home's location, such as a homeowner's or condominium association. Both the property owner and the renter should sign and date the agreement, and a copy should be kept by both parties.
Decide if you desire to record it yourself or whether you need to list your vacation property through a property management company. A third party is a superb choice for those who do not need to handle transaction, paperwork, and the renter screenings. Remember that a management company can also be hired to take care of problems and maintenance that could arise with renters. This is especially useful if you do not live close enough to the property to handle problems promptly or if you do not possess the time to rectify a tenant's difficulty on short notice.

The contract should also contain a cancellation policy that'll discourage a renter from backing out of the transaction. The contract should include a good faith clause which will release the renter from the contract if a calamity occurs before the lease and renders the property uninhabitable if the property is in a place prone to natural disasters including floods, hurricanes or earthquakes.
Have all terms for the vacation home rental in writing. The contract must say the location of the property, dates of leasing, total rental cost and rent payment program. Any individual policies for example policies relating to pets, smoking, and occupancy limitations also must be in the contract. Comprise a damages clause, which specifies deposit rules and monetary repercussions affecting any damages.
